Variations of Pineapple Dole Whip Margarita
If you love the Pineapple Dole Whip Margarita but want to switch things up, there are several delicious variations to explore. Each version maintains the tropical essence while introducing unique flavors to delight your palate.
Fruity Additions
One simple way to enhance your margarita is by incorporating other fruits. Adding mango or strawberry can elevate the drink’s sweetness and provide a colorful twist. Just blend in one cup of your chosen fruit along with the pineapple for a delightful fusion.
Frozen Delight
For an even more indulgent experience, freeze your ingredients before blending. Using frozen pineapple chunks and Dole Whip creates a slushy, ice-cold texture that’s perfect for hot summer days. This variation is not only refreshing but also visually stunning when served in a chilled glass.
Coconut Twist
If you’re a coconut lover, try increasing the amount of coconut cream to 1/2 cup for an extra creamy, tropical flavor. You can also experiment with adding coconut rum instead of tequila for a sweeter, island-inspired cocktail.
Non-Alcoholic Option
For those who prefer a non-alcoholic drink, simply omit the tequila and replace it with coconut water or sparkling water. This variation allows everyone to enjoy the tropical flavors without the alcohol, making it perfect for family gatherings or brunches.

Cooking Tips and Notes
Creating the perfect Pineapple Dole Whip Margarita is all about the details. Here are some cooking tips and notes to ensure your drink is both delicious and visually appealing.
Fresh Ingredients Matter
Using fresh pineapple chunks is crucial for that authentic tropical flavor. If you can, opt for ripe pineapple to get the sweetest taste. Additionally, fresh lime juice will enhance the drink’s brightness, making the flavors pop. Avoid bottled juices when possible for the best results.
Blend to Perfection
Achieving the right consistency is key. Blend your mixture until it’s smooth and creamy, but be careful not to over-blend, as this can lead to a watery texture. A high-speed blender works wonders here, ensuring every ingredient is well incorporated without ice chunks.
Serve Immediately
This margarita is best enjoyed fresh and cold. The longer it sits, the more the ice melts, diluting the flavors. Prepare your glasses ahead of time by chilling them in the freezer or rimming them with salt to enhance the drinking experience.

Pineapple Dole Whip Margarita
- Total Time: 10 minutes
- Yield: 2 servings 1x
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
A tropical twist on the classic margarita, combining the flavors of pineapple and creamy Dole Whip.
Ingredients
- 2 cups pineapple chunks
- 1 cup Dole Whip (or pineapple sorbet)
- 1/2 cup tequila
- 1/4 cup lime juice
- 1/4 cup coconut cream
- 1 tablespoon agave syrup (optional)
- Salt for rimming the glass
- Pineapple slices for garnish
Instructions
- Begin by rimming your glass with salt. Use a lime wedge to wet the rim, then dip it into salt.
- In a blender, combine pineapple chunks, Dole Whip (or pineapple sorbet), tequila, lime juice, coconut cream, and agave syrup if desired.
- Blend until smooth and creamy.
- Pour the mixture into the prepared glass.
- Garnish with a slice of pineapple on the rim.
- Serve immediately and enjoy your tropical drink!
Notes
- This drink is best served fresh and cold.
- Adjust sweetness by adding more or less agave syrup.
- For a non-alcoholic version, skip the tequila.
